青青草原综合久久大伊人导航_色综合久久天天综合_日日噜噜夜夜狠狠久久丁香五月_热久久这里只有精品
Good Good code,Day Day up
PearLi's Blog
C++博客
首頁
新隨筆
聯系
聚合
管理
統計
隨筆 - 50
文章 - 42
評論 - 147
引用 - 0
留言簿
(6)
給我留言
查看公開留言
查看私人留言
隨筆分類
Algorithm(5)
(rss)
asp.net(3)
(rss)
C#/.net(3)
(rss)
C++ (22)
(rss)
DSP
(rss)
Linux/Unix (3)
(rss)
perl(2)
(rss)
Translate(2)
(rss)
windows kernel(4)
(rss)
讀書雜記(2)
(rss)
文章分類
Algorithm(2)
(rss)
Batch processing(2)
(rss)
C++(20)
(rss)
CUDA
(rss)
DSP(1)
(rss)
Encode&Decode
(rss)
Linux/Unix(10)
(rss)
MFC
(rss)
Version control(1)
(rss)
windows kernel(5)
(rss)
WorkDiary
(rss)
雷達(3)
(rss)
心靈點滴,兼修內外
(rss)
Link
Google Earth Watch
Ntdebugging Blog
搜索
積分與排名
積分 - 167183
排名 - 159
最新評論
1.?re: C++堆棧祥解
hao
--李云濤
2.?re: 對于c++中常量成員函數,返回常量引用,const_cast的總結[未登錄]
{ return (isbn rhs.isbn);}
這里是不是掉東西了?前面的isbn表示什么?
--gong
3.?re: 詳解virtual table
@xxx
支持,作者怎么還不改過來,怪不得程序讀起來怪怪的
--ntwarren
4.?re: vmware橋接方式的設置
還是不行啊
--topin
5.?re: MSVC++ 對象內存模型深入解析與具體應用 (二)
如果把內存布局畫成圖就更好了,像《Inside the C++ Object Model》那樣。感謝樓主的文章。學習了
--劉偉
閱讀排行榜
1.?WTL---WxWidget---MFC 何去何從(14073)
2.?詳解virtual table(8777)
3.?cygwin 使用 (6589)
4.?windows session機制深入解析(上)(6535)
5.?C++堆棧祥解(5305)
評論排行榜
1.?WTL---WxWidget---MFC 何去何從(25)
2.?寫了一個關閉電腦屏幕的服務程序(15)
3.?再談拷貝構造函數(Copy Constructor Function)(12)
4.?cygwin 使用 (10)
5.?尋找k大(10)
STL寫的字符替換程序
最近看關聯容器相關章節,寫了以下程序,作用是先從傳入參數的第一個文件中讀入鍵值對,key是目標字串,mapped是要替換的字串,然其后傳入文件里的相關字串
1
#include
<
map
>
2
#include
<
iostream
>
3
#include
<
sstream
>
4
#include
<
fstream
>
5
#include
<
string
>
6
#include
<
stdexcept
>
7
using
namespace
std;
8
int
9
main(
int
args,
char
*
argv[])
10
{
11
try
12
{
13
if
(args
<
3
)
14
throw
runtime_error(
"
缺少參數,請輸入。。。
"
);
15
ifstream fin;
16
fin.open(argv[
1
]);
17
if
(
!
fin) //檢查文件是否被正確打開
18
throw
runtime_error(
"
map file not found
"
);
19
string
keystr,mapstr;
20
map
<
string
,
string
>
mappedctner;
21
while
(fin
>>
keystr
>>
mapstr)
22
{
23
mappedctner[keystr]
=
mapstr;//采用下標引用的方法插入元素
24
}
25
for
(
int
cnt(
2
);cnt
!=
args;cnt
++
)
26
{
27
fin.close();
28
fin.clear();
29
fin.open(argv[cnt]);
30
stringstream sstr;
31
sstr
<<
"
target file
"
<<
cnt
-
1
<<
"
not found
"
<<
endl;//格式化字串
32
if
(
!
fin)
33
throw
runtime_error(sstr.str());//str()成員存儲輸入的文本對象
34
map
<
string
,
string
>
::iterator itr;
35
while
(fin
>>
keystr)
36
{
37
if
((itr
=
mappedctner.find(keystr))
!=
mappedctner.end())
38
keystr
=
itr
->
second;//找到相關字串,利用迭代器引用second的mappedvalue類型替換
39
cout
<<
keystr
<<
"
"
;
40
}
41
cout
<<
endl;
42
}
43
}
44
catch
(runtime_error e)
45
{
46
cout
<<
e.what()
<<
endl;
47
}
48
catch
(ios_base::failure e)
49
{
50
cout
<<
e.what()
<<
endl;
51
}
52
return
0
;
53
}
54
posted on 2008-12-03 17:27
pear_li
閱讀(665)
評論(0)
編輯
收藏
引用
所屬分類:
C++
只有注冊用戶
登錄
后才能發表評論。
相關文章:
MSVC++ 對象內存模型深入解析與具體應用 (三)
從小函數實現看應聘者的編程素質(atoi.strcmp...)
A*算法實現
簡版 容器vector 實現
0-1背包問題
八皇后問題一解--用幾何方法簡化編程問題
寫了一個關閉電腦屏幕的服務程序
用之前寫的物理模擬引擎編寫了個小游戲
vc也搞for each
對象與對象的類型信息----獲取對象的RTTI信息
網站導航:
博客園
IT新聞
BlogJava
博問
Chat2DB
管理
Powered by:
C++博客
Copyright © pear_li
青青草原综合久久大伊人导航_色综合久久天天综合_日日噜噜夜夜狠狠久久丁香五月_热久久这里只有精品
欧美激情网友自拍
|
亚洲一级黄色片
|
99精品99久久久久久宅男
|
亚洲视频在线二区
|
久久久噜噜噜久久
|
一本高清dvd不卡在线观看
|
欧美一级淫片播放口
|
欧美四级在线观看
|
日韩亚洲在线观看
|
亚洲欧洲一区
|
欧美精品在欧美一区二区少妇
|
激情小说亚洲一区
|
欧美亚洲一区二区三区
|
亚洲精选视频在线
|
美日韩精品免费
|
亚洲欧洲精品一区二区三区波多野1战4
|
久久亚洲私人国产精品va
|
亚洲精品你懂的
|
欧美国产在线观看
|
亚洲精品久久久久久久久久久
|
性色av一区二区三区在线观看
|
中日韩高清电影网
|
老司机一区二区
|
欧美大片一区二区
|
亚洲午夜精品久久久久久app
|
欧美+亚洲+精品+三区
|
麻豆freexxxx性91精品
|
亚洲缚视频在线观看
|
欧美成人精品三级在线观看
|
一区二区精品在线观看
|
欧美日韩国产欧
|
午夜精品国产
|
亚洲欧洲一二三
|
欧美激情中文字幕一区二区
|
亚洲激情视频在线观看
|
亚洲国产日韩在线
|
免费成人av资源网
|
亚洲激情自拍
|
欧美亚洲一区二区在线观看
|
亚洲清纯自拍
|
亚洲一区二区成人
|
亚洲欧洲视频
|
亚洲国产日韩欧美一区二区三区
|
欧美国产三级
|
久久人人97超碰国产公开结果
|
男人的天堂亚洲
|
在线观看一区
|
欧美中文字幕在线观看
|
亚洲欧洲综合另类
|
久久黄色级2电影
|
一区二区三区精品
|
欧美精品自拍偷拍动漫精品
|
蜜臀99久久精品久久久久久软件
|
久久偷窥视频
|
国产一区二区三区在线免费观看
|
国产日韩欧美
|
亚洲欧美日韩成人
|
亚洲一区欧美一区
|
国产精品久久久99
|
亚洲欧美另类综合偷拍
|
久久激情五月丁香伊人
|
亚洲成人在线网
|
欧美另类变人与禽xxxxx
|
亚洲视频免费看
|
亚洲第一视频网站
|
久久九九国产精品
|
亚洲狼人精品一区二区三区
|
欧美视频在线一区
|
牛人盗摄一区二区三区视频
|
亚洲人成7777
|
久久综合伊人77777
|
亚洲一区二区精品在线观看
|
黑丝一区二区三区
|
国产午夜精品久久久
|
欧美视频日韩视频
|
欧美激情视频给我
|
米奇777在线欧美播放
|
欧美诱惑福利视频
|
亚洲欧美日韩专区
|
亚洲午夜久久久
|
99re在线精品
|
99精品国产一区二区青青牛奶
|
欧美成人激情视频
|
欧美国产精品v
|
老色鬼久久亚洲一区二区
|
久久精品国产久精国产思思
|
午夜日韩福利
|
国产精品vvv
|
蜜桃av一区二区在线观看
|
夜夜嗨av一区二区三区
|
午夜视频在线观看一区
|
日韩视频在线播放
|
91久久久久久久久久久久久
|
在线观看不卡
|
一本一道久久综合狠狠老精东影业
|
亚洲欧美日韩精品久久奇米色影视
|
韩国av一区二区三区四区
|
国产嫩草一区二区三区在线观看
|
欧美手机在线视频
|
国产综合色一区二区三区
|
好看的亚洲午夜视频在线
|
在线免费一区三区
|
在线观看亚洲视频啊啊啊啊
|
国产一区二区三区在线免费观看
|
狠狠狠色丁香婷婷综合久久五月
|
亚洲网站在线
|
麻豆成人小视频
|
一区二区免费在线播放
|
99天天综合性
|
亚洲精品看片
|
亚洲视频网在线直播
|
欧美一级一区
|
久久黄色网页
|
免费在线观看日韩欧美
|
欧美日本高清视频
|
国产精品青草久久久久福利99
|
国产精品日韩欧美
|
国产日韩综合一区二区性色av
|
国产一区亚洲一区
|
亚洲一级在线观看
|
国产亚洲综合精品
|
一本色道88久久加勒比精品
|
欧美理论电影在线播放
|
国产精品日韩专区
|
一区二区三区欧美在线
|
久久在线视频在线
|
欧美一区二粉嫩精品国产一线天
|
欧美激情亚洲视频
|
一本色道久久88综合日韩精品
|
亚洲国产成人久久综合
|
美女主播精品视频一二三四
|
在线精品视频一区二区
|
欧美成人综合网站
|
欧美国产一区在线
|
亚洲一区二区三区激情
|
在线视频精品一
|
国产一区二区中文
|
欧美福利一区二区
|
欧美日韩国产欧
|
欧美在线播放视频
|
欧美成人久久
|
小嫩嫩精品导航
|
久久久综合香蕉尹人综合网
|
亚洲人体影院
|
亚洲女同同性videoxma
|
久久久久9999亚洲精品
|
国产精品女主播一区二区三区
|
欧美一区高清
|
欧美极品一区二区三区
|
久久久青草婷婷精品综合日韩
|
亚洲尤物视频在线
|
亚洲国内欧美
|
亚洲一区三区在线观看
|
99riav国产精品
|
久久久久久夜
|
欧美综合国产
|
久久综合狠狠综合久久综青草
|
久久精品人人
|
韩国av一区二区三区在线观看
|
国产一区日韩一区
|
久久久久中文
|
国产精品永久免费视频
|
亚洲精品欧洲
|
国产视频一区欧美
|
免费日韩精品中文字幕视频在线
|
亚洲国产成人porn
|
亚洲电影激情视频网站
|
午夜精品视频在线
|
欧美一区二区国产
|
国产精品免费网站
|
亚洲欧洲精品成人久久奇米网
|
欧美亚洲一区三区
|
欧美日韩三级在线
|
日韩午夜在线电影
|
亚洲香蕉在线观看
|
欧美日韩色一区
|
亚洲视频在线二区
|
午夜精品在线观看
|
国产伦精品一区二区三区免费
|
午夜精品福利一区二区三区av
|
久久久蜜臀国产一区二区
|
亚洲第一色在线
|
欧美日韩亚洲一区二区三区四区
|
一本久久精品一区二区
|
午夜精品国产
|
激情婷婷久久
|
欧美日韩三级视频
|
亚洲精品在线免费
|
精品动漫一区二区
|
国产美女精品免费电影
|
欧美午夜宅男影院在线观看
|
久久九九精品99国产精品
|
麻豆av一区二区三区
|
一区二区三区久久久
|
亚洲人成在线播放
|
亚洲国产精品成人久久综合一区
|
国产欧美日韩亚洲
|
国产欧美一区二区色老头
|
欧美自拍丝袜亚洲
|
亚洲欧美在线一区二区
|